ORANJESTAD, Aruba — Officials in Aruba are looking into a devastating incident at The St. Regis Aruba Resort involving a tourist couple who were visiting the island for their honeymoon. Authorities have described the case as an apparent murder-suicide.

Police said the incident took place during the morning hours. Emergency crews were dispatched to the resort after a disturbance was reported inside a guest room. Upon arrival, responders found two adults, later identified as a married couple on a honeymoon trip, deceased at the scene.

Several resort guests reported seeing a heavy law enforcement presence and said access to certain areas of the property was temporarily restricted while investigators worked. Some guests were redirected away from common spaces as resort staff coordinated with authorities to maintain safety and discretion.

The identities of the victims have not been released as officials work to notify family members. Authorities have shared only limited information out of respect for those affected and have confirmed there is no danger to other guests or the public.

Police say the investigation is ongoing and have asked the public to refrain from speculation, urging reliance on verified updates from official sources.

The incident has deeply affected both guests and employees at the resort. Representatives from the property expressed sympathy for the families involved and stated they are fully cooperating with authorities while providing support to staff and guests impacted by the event.

As details continue to emerge, messages of condolence have come from travelers and members of the community. Authorities say additional information will be released as it becomes available, and anyone with relevant information is encouraged to contact local law enforcement.
